Hospitals play a crucial role in our communities by providing essential medical care to the public. However, they also generate a significant amount of waste that needs to be properly managed and disposed of. Hospital waste, also known as medical or clinical waste, is defined as any waste generated during the diagnosis, treatment, or immunization of human beings or animals.
Due to the potential biohazards present in hospital waste, it is essential to have a specialized disposal system in place to ensure the safety of both healthcare workers and the general public. One of the most effective methods of disposing of hospital waste is through the use of a hospital waste incinerator.
A hospital waste incinerator is a specially designed facility that is used to burn medical waste at very high temperatures, effectively reducing it to ash. This process not only eliminates harmful pathogens and bacteria but also reduces the volume of waste, making it easier to manage and dispose of.

Despite the many advantages of hospital waste incinerators, there are some concerns and challenges associated with their use. One of the main issues is the potential release of harmful emissions and pollutants into the atmosphere during the incineration process. To address this, modern hospital waste incinerators are equipped with advanced pollution control systems that help minimize the impact on air quality.
Another challenge is the proper segregation and sorting of different types of medical waste before incineration. Certain types of waste, such as sharps or radioactive materials, require special handling and disposal procedures to ensure safety and compliance with regulations. Healthcare facilities must implement strict protocols for waste segregation to avoid any potential risks or hazards.
